GOODWILL VISIT.

BRITISH SQUADRON. Five Battleships . Due At . Constantinople. INVITATION OF TURKS. (British Official Wireless.) RUGBY, September IS. The battleship Queen Elizabeth, the aircraft-carrier Courageous, three destroyers and the Bryony, the yacht of . the Commander-in-Chief, Admiral Sir 11.I 1 . L. Field, are due to arrive at Constantinople on October 12 for a stay of nine days at the. invitation of the Turkish Government. The arrangements made provide for a visit of the Commander-in-Chief to the Premier, Ismet Pasha, at Angora and for his reception by the President, Mustapha Kemal Pasha, in or near Constantinople. This will be the first occasion on which a British naval squadron will have passed through the Dardanelles since the crisis of 1922. The Queen Elizabeth, flagship of the Mediterranean Fleet, played an important part in the operations agamst the i Dardanelles during the war. The Courageous is Britain's latest aircraitcarrier. She is of 18,600 tons with a speed of 31 knots.
